estructura KSPROPERTY_SERIAL (ks.h)

La estructura KSPROPERTY_SERIAL es un encabezado que se incluye para cada propiedad que sigue una estructura de KSPROPERTY_SERIALHDR .

Sintaxis

typedef struct {
  KSIDENTIFIER PropTypeSet;
  ULONG        Id;
  ULONG        PropertyLength;
} KSPROPERTY_SERIAL, *PKSPROPERTY_SERIAL;

Miembros

PropTypeSet

Estructura de tipo KSIDENTIFIER que especifica el tipo de datos de propiedad. Esta es la misma información obtenida de la consulta de soporte técnico básico.

Id

Especifica el identificador de esta propiedad.

PropertyLength

Especifica la longitud, en bytes, de los datos de propiedad siguientes. Esto no incluye ningún almacenamiento en búfer de alineación que se pueda anexar a los datos de propiedad antes de la siguiente propiedad en la serialización.

Comentarios

Una estructura de KSPROPERTY_SERIAL va seguida de los datos de propiedad, con el inicio de cada propiedad en FILE_LONG_ALIGNMENT. Tenga en cuenta que la propia estructura de encabezado serie también está definida para estar en FILE_LONG_ALIGNMENT.

Requisitos

Requisito Valor
Header ks.h (incluye Ks.h)

Consulte también

KSPROPERTY

KSPROPERTY_SERIALHDR